23.01.2022 Feeling the Chill? Joints aching? Book in and try some Hydrotherapy! What better way to mobilise your joints and strengthen your muscles in a warm pool and rela...xing environment Call Somerville Physiotherapy on 59 777 577 HYDROTHERAPY Hydrotherapy or Aquatic Physiotherapy, refers to a specific form of physiotherapy treatment in a heated pool supervised by an experienced physiotherapist The warmth and buoyancy of the water can help to reduce muscle spasm, increase circulation, decrease pain and regain normal movement by reducing gravitational compression and aiding support. It is beneficial for people of all ages and is available to private, TAC, DVA ,Workcover and clients under an EPC program. Typical conditions treated are : Total Knee and Hip replacements Low back pain and Sciatica Shoulder surgery and repairs Post Fractures Knee reconstructions /Arthroscopic surgery Poor Balance and de-conditioning. Arthritis For further information or to book an appointment please ring the clinic on 59777577

Cameron Dunkerley Dear Clients, We cannot operate business as usual and routine treatment is not permitted. Our face-to-face care of patients must only occur if the absence or delay of such care would result in a significant change or deterioration in the patients functional independence that would necessitate an escalation of care. This directive is from the DHHS: to provide services that prevent a significant change/deterioration in functional independence necessitating escalation of care (e.g. a requirement for specialist input/review, an increase in care needs and/or alternate accommodation, avoiding a hospital admission or emergency department presentation). If you have any doubt whether you qualify for a face- to face appointment, please ring the clinic on 59777577 and discuss your individual circumstances with one of our Physiotherapists. Consultations can also be carried out via Telehealth over the phone or internet with your Physiotherapist
